    Implementation of a 2.5Gb/s ATM transceiver in GaAs technology

    In this paper we present a 0.6um GaAs MESFET im­plementation for a 2.5Gb/s ATM transceiver. The good power-delay feature of the technology, gives a power con­sumption below 5W for the transceiver. Due to the lack of recommendations for 2.5Gb/s ATM physical layer, the work presented uses the existing recommendations given by the ITU-T for 155Mb/s and 622Mb/s
